Abstract

The utility model discloses a kind of automated production decontaminating apparatus of polymer stabilizer, including the square type post above frame, U-shaped sliding seat and cleaning device, U-shaped sliding seat is slidably mounted on the both sides of square type post, the first motor is installed in the top inner wall of the U-shaped sliding seat, and first motor output shaft on the transmission device being connected with square type column top is installed, the second motor is installed above the top outer of the U-shaped sliding seat, and the adjustment seat of square type structure is welded with the output shaft of the second motor.The utility model is economical and practical, first motor drives cleaning device to carry out horizontal level movement by transmission device, so that high to the cleaning efficiency of automated production equipment, and the distance between cleaning device and automated production equipment can be adjusted according to being actually needed so that cleaning device is good to the cleaning performance of automated production equipment.

Background technology
Polymer stabilizer is to increase solution, colloid, solid, the stability chemicals of mixture, polymer stabilizer With reaction is slowed down, chemical balance is kept, surface tension is reduced, prevents the effect of light, thermal decomposition or oxidation Decomposition, polymer is steady Determine agent and need to use automated production equipment in process of production, the automated production equipment of polymer stabilizer is cleaning When, all completed by manually so that staff is relatively low to the cleaning efficiency of automated production equipment.

Reference picture 1-3, the automated production decontaminating apparatus of polymer stabilizer, including the square type above frame Post 1, U-shaped sliding seat 3 and cleaning device 18, the both sides of square type post 1 are slidably fitted with same U-shaped sliding seat 3, U-shaped sliding seat 3 Top inner wall on the first motor 4 is installed, and be provided with the output shaft of the first motor 4 and the top of square type post 1 The transmission device being connected, the top side of U-shaped sliding seat 3 is provided with the second motor 6, and the second motor 6 is defeated It is welded with the adjustment seat 7 of square type structure on shaft, the side of adjustment seat 7 offers the first standing groove 8, and the first standing groove 8 Two the second standing grooves 9 are offered on the inwall of both sides, two the second standing grooves on the same side inwall of the first standing groove 8 9 are symmetrical arranged, and the inner vertical of the second standing groove 9 is welded with guide rod 10, and the outside of guide rod 10 is equidistantly inlaid with more Group ball set, and ball set includes multiple vertical balls 11 for being embedded in the outside of guide rod 10, the inside of the first standing groove 8 is placed There is a sliding seat 12, and the outside of sliding seat 12 is welded with the connecting rod 13 that position matches with guide rod 10, the one of connecting rod 13 End is welded with sleeve pipe 14, and the inner side of sleeve pipe 14 and ball 11 roll connection, and the top of adjustment seat 7 is provided with the 3rd motor 15, and be welded with the output shaft of the 3rd motor 15 through whole sliding seat 12 and turn with the bottom interior wall of the first standing groove 8 The screw mandrel 16 of dynamic installation, adjustment seat 7 are provided with L-type connecting rod 17, and the one of L-type connecting rod 17 close to the side of the first standing groove 8 End is welded with the phase of sliding seat 12, and the other end of L-type connecting rod 17 is welded with cleaning device 18, and cleaning device 18 is located at U-shaped cunning The side of dynamic seat 3, the inside both sides of U-shaped sliding seat 3 offer the chute 20 that both sides set opening, and chute 20 is slidably connected There is the sliding block 19 with the welding of the phase of square type post 1, transmission device includes the round gear 5 mutually welded with the output shaft of the first motor 4, And round gear 5 is engaged with the straight trip rack 2 mutually welded with the top of square type post 1, the water inlet of cleaning device 18 is connected with water delivery Flexible pipe, and one end of delivery hose is connected with the storage tank being connected with the U-shaped top opposite side of sliding seat 3, the water outlet of storage tank Mouth and delivery hose junction are provided with micro motor, and the screw thread that position matches with screw mandrel 16 is offered on sliding seat 12 and is led to Hole, and the inner side of tapped through hole and the outside of screw mandrel 16 are meshed, cleaning device 18 are hollow structure, and the bottom of cleaning device 18 Portion offers multiple first mounting grooves, is offered in the top inner wall of each first mounting groove inside multiple and cleaning device 18 The limbers being connected, the inner rotation of the first mounting groove is provided with cleaning brush, and the bottom of cleaning brush extends to cleaning device 18 lower section.
In the utility model, when decontaminating apparatus cleans to automated production equipment, start the second driving electricity first Machine 6, the second motor 6 drives adjustment seat 7 to be rotated, until the cleaning device 18 in L-type connecting rod 17 is moved to automatically Change the surface of production equipment, then start the 3rd motor 15, the 3rd motor 15 drives screw mandrel 16 to be placed first Rotated in the bottom interior wall of groove 8, because screw mandrel 16 and tapped through hole are meshed, screw mandrel 16 drives sliding seat 12 to be put first The inside for putting groove 8 carries out position movement, and sliding seat 12 drives the sleeve pipe 14 in connecting rod 13 to enter line position in the outside of guide rod 10 Put movement so that the inner side of sleeve pipe 14 is rolled on ball 11, while sliding seat 12 drives the cleaning in L-type connecting rod 17 The in the vertical direction of device 18 carries out position movement so that cleaning brush and automated cleaning equipment in cleaning device 18 carry out tight Contiguity is touched, and finally starts the first motor 4, and the first motor 4 drives round gear 5 to be rotated on straight trip rack 2, So that chute 20 on U-shaped sliding seat 3, in 19 enterprising line slip of sliding block, now the cleaning device 18 in L-type connecting rod 17 is U-shaped Under the drive of sliding seat 3, the cleaning brush in cleaning device 18 cleans to automatic producing device, while in cleaning device 18 Water is dropped onto on cleaning brush by limbers so that cleaning device 18 is high to the cleaning efficiency of automated production equipment.
